23 And he said, Why wilt thou go to him to-day? It is neither new moon nor sabbath. And she said, [It is] well.

24 Then she saddled the ass, and said to her servant, Drive and go forward; slack not the riding for me, except I bid thee.

25 And she went and came to the man of God, to mount Carmel. And it came to pass when the man of God saw her afar off, that he said to Gehazi his servant, Behold, there is the Shunammite:

23 “Why go to him today?” he asked. “It’s not the New Moon(A) or the Sabbath.”

“That’s all right,” she said.

24 She saddled the donkey and said to her servant, “Lead on; don’t slow down for me unless I tell you.” 25 So she set out and came to the man of God at Mount Carmel.(B)

When he saw her in the distance, the man of God said to his servant Gehazi, “Look! There’s the Shunammite!
